Preheat the oven to 375 degrees Fahrenheit.
Remove the tofu from the container and drain out all excess liquid.
Place it between two towels and gently pat it to get some liquid out. If you have time, press it for about 20 minutes, but don't worry if you skip that step, it still turns out great.
Cut the tofu into about 1 inch cubes and add to a food processor.
Add in all remaining ingredients.
Pulse a few times, scrape down the sides, and pulse again. It should only really take a few spins of the food processor to get the right consistency. You want the tofu, walnuts and chipotle peppers broken up, but not completely mushy. See photos for reference.
Transfer to a baking sheet lined with parchment paper or foil.
Bake for 30 minutes, stirring halfway through to break up any larger chunks and to ensure the edges don't burn. When you stir, try to mix it up really well so everything cooks evenly.
Remove from oven and serve in tacos or burrito bowls!
